Как исправить зависимости Maven, если методы из com.google.common.base.Stopwatch не найдены?JAVA

Программисты JAVA общаются здесь
Ответить
Anonymous
 Как исправить зависимости Maven, если методы из com.google.common.base.Stopwatch не найдены?

Сообщение Anonymous »

Я использую облачное хранилище Google для чтения файлов из него. Он работает, когда я создаю его изнутри Eclipse. Но когда я собираю его с помощью maven, он компилируется, но завершается с ошибкой во время выполнения (когда я собираю с помощью eclipse вообще никаких исключений во время выполнения)

Мне нужна помощь, см. исключение после выполнения сборки через Maven:

java.lang.NoSuchMethodError: com.google.common.base.Stopwatch.createUnstarted()Lcom/google/common/base/Stopwatch;
at com.google.appengine.tools.cloudstorage.RetryHelper.runWithRetries(RetryHelper.java:156)
at com.google.appengine.tools.cloudstorage.GcsServiceImpl.getMetadata(GcsServiceImpl.java:132)


Вот связанный Maven POM, который я использую:


4.0.0
selectmediaservers
selectmediaservers
1
war

1.7
1.7
ISO-8859-1



${project.basedir}/Server/Cloud/selectmediaservers/target
${project.build.directory}/classes
Server/Cloud/selectmediaservers



com.google.appengine
appengine-maven-plugin
1.9.46

debug
false
info
2
${VER}




org.apache.maven.plugins
maven-war-plugin
2.3

${project.basedir}/Server/Cloud/selectmediaservers/war/WEB-INF/web.xml
${project.basedir}/Server/Cloud/selectmediaservers/war


${project.basedir}/Server/Cloud/selectmediaservers/war

${project.basedir}/Server/Cloud/selectmediaservers/war/WEB-INF/appengine-web.xml
${project.basedir}/Server/Cloud/selectmediaservers/war/WEB-INF/web.xml










com.google.guava
guava
19.0-rc1


com.sendgrid
sendgrid-java
2.2.1


com.fasterxml.jackson.core
jackson-core
2.8.5


com.google.guava
guava-jdk5




javax.servlet
javax.servlet-api
3.1.0


com.google.guava
guava-jdk5




com.google.code.gson
gson
2.7
compile


com.google.guava
guava-jdk5




com.google.apis
google-api-services-bigquery
v2-rev330-1.22.0


com.google.guava
guava-jdk5




com.google.appengine
appengine-api-1.0-sdk
1.9.46


com.google.guava
guava-jdk5




com.google.appengine
appengine-api-labs
1.9.46


com.google.guava
guava-jdk5


`enter code here`

nl.bitwalker
UserAgentUtils
1.2.4


com.google.guava
guava-jdk5


< b r / > & l t ; d e p e n d e n c y & g t ; < b r / > & l t ; g r o u p I d & g t ; c o m . g o o g l e . a p p e n g i n e . t o o l s & l t ; / g r o u p I d & g t ; < b r / > & l t ; a r t i f a c t I d & g t ; a p p e n g i n e - g c s - c l i e n t & l t ; / a r t i f a c t I d & g t ; < b r / > & l t ; v e r s i o n & g t ; 0 . 6 & l t ; / v e r s i o n & g t ; < b r / > & l t ; e x c l u s i o n s & g t ; < b r / > & l t ; e x c l u s i o n & g t ; < b r / > & l t ; g r o u p I d & g t ; c o m . g o o g l e . g u a v a & l t ; / g r o u p I d & g t ; < b r / > & l t ; a r t i f a c t I d & g t ; g u a v a - j d k 5 & l t ; / a r t i f a c t I d & g t ; < b r / > & l t ; / e x c l u s i o n & g t ; < b r / > & l t ; / e x c l u s i o n s & g t ; < b r / > & l t ; / d e p e n d e n c y & g t ; < b r / > & l t ; d e p e n d e n c y & g t ; < b r / > & l t ; g r o u p I d & g t ; j o d a - t i m e & l t ; / g r o u p I d & g t ; < b r / > & l t ; a r t i f a c t I d & g t ; j o d a - t i m e & l t ; / a r t i f a c t I d & g t ; < b r / > & l t ; v e r s i o n & g t ; 2 . 9 . 6 & l t ; / v e r s i o n & g t ; < b r / > & l t ; / d e p e n d e n c y & g t ; < b r / > & l t ; d e p e n d e n c y & g t ; < b r / > & l t ; g r o u p I d & g t ; c o m . g o o g l e . a p i s & l t ; / g r o u p I d & g t ; < b r / > & l t ; a r t i f a c t I d & g t ; g o o g l e - a p i - s e r v i c e s - s t o r a g e & l t ; / a r t i f a c t I d & g t ; < b r / > & l t ; v e r s i o n & g t ; v 1 - r e v 9 2 - 1 . 2 2 . 0 & l t ; / v e r s i o n & g t ; < b r / > & l t ; e x c l u s i o n s & g t ; < b r / > & l t ; e x c l u s i o n & g t ; < b r / > & l t ; g r o u p I d & g t ; c o m . g o o g l e . g u a v a & l t ; / g r o u p I d & g t ; < b r / > & l t ; a r t i f a c t I d & g t ; g u a v a - j d k 5 & l t ; / a r t i f a c t I d & g t ; < b r / > & l t ; / e x c l u s i o n & g t ; < b r / > & l t ; / e x c l u s i o n s & g t ; < b r / > & l t ; / d e p e n d e n c y & g t ; < b r / > & l t ; d e p e n d e n c y & g t ; < b r / > & l t ; g r o u p I d & g t ; c o m . g o o g l e . a p i - c l i e n t & l t ; / g r o u p I d & g t ; < b r / > & l t ; a r t i f a c t I d & g t ; g o o g l e - a p i - c l i e n t & l t ; / a r t i f a c t I d & g t ; < b r / > & l t ; v e r s i o n & g t ; 1 . 2 2 . 0 & l t ;/version>


com.google.guava
guava-jdk5




com.google.api-client
google-api-client-servlet
1.22.0


com.google.guava
guava-jdk5




com.google.api-client
google-api-client-appengine
1.22.0


com.google.guava
guava-jdk5




com.google.http-client
google-http-client-jackson2
1.22.0


com.google.guava
guava-jdk5




com.fasterxml.jackson.core
jackson-databind
2.8.5


com.google.guava
guava-jdk5




com.google.code.findbugs
jsr305
3.0.1


com.google.oauth-client
google-oauth-client
1.22.0


com.google.guava
guava-jdk5




com.google.oauth-client
google-oauth-client-appengine
1.22.0


com.google.guava
guava-jdk5




com.google.http-client
google-http-client-jdo
1.22.0


com.google.guava
guava-jdk5







Подробнее здесь: https://stackoverflow.com/questions/408 ... ase-stopwa
Ответить

Быстрый ответ

Изменение регистра текста: 
Смайлики
:) :( :oops: :roll: :wink: :muza: :clever: :sorry: :angel: :read: *x)
Ещё смайлики…
   
К этому ответу прикреплено по крайней мере одно вложение.

Если вы не хотите добавлять вложения, оставьте поля пустыми.

Максимально разрешённый размер вложения: 15 МБ.

Вернуться в «JAVA»